The Incident: A Disturbing Attack
On a seemingly ordinary day, a subway car became the scene of an extraordinary tragedy. Witnesses reported chaos as the accused allegedly doused a female passenger in a flammable liquid before igniting it. The act was not only horrific but also brazen, occurring in a public space where many commuters expect safety and security. Eyewitness accounts detail the panic that ensued, with bystanders rushing to help the victim and alert authorities.
The victim, whose identity remains undisclosed due to privacy concerns, suffered severe injuries and is currently receiving treatment in a local hospital. Her condition is reportedly stable, but the psychological and physical scars from such a traumatic event will likely last a lifetime.
The Accused: Facing Justice
The accused, a man in his late 30s, was apprehended shortly after the incident. Law enforcement officials have described him as having a history of violent behavior, raising numerous questions about how such individuals slip through the cracks of a system designed to protect the public. As he faces charges of attempted murder, arson, and assault, many are asking how accountability will be ensured moving forward.
During the upcoming arraignment, the prosecution will likely present evidence that includes surveillance footage and eyewitness testimonies.
